13/7/2009 // Todmorden high school,

graffiti art mural workshop // Project - Incredible Edibles

 

 

   

 

 At work the students are filling in their designs with organic spray paints!
 

At work! The students filling in their designs with organic spray paints. 

Faunagraphic returned to her roots and the school she once attended to deliver a graffiti art workshop to Year 9 students. The project was based on the Incredible Edibles, an innovative scheme in Todmorden where organic crops are planted all over the town by the locals and free to take to eat. http://www.incredible-edible-todmorden.co.uk/ .

Todmorden High School is already heavily involved with this interesting project and has their own organic vegetable garden. The crops that they grow are then used in the school's food technology lessons.  

The students at the High School designed a mural which will be placed next to the organic garden with the aim of guiding people towards this vegetable heaven! 
 

 

 

 

 08/07/2009 - Glossopdale community College, Mural art Workshop

 

 

 

Glossopdale Community College held workshops throughout the summer for their new and current students. This included breakdancing, circus skills, rapping and beat boxing, as well as graffiti spray can art delivered by Faunagraphic.

The students designed and painted their lunch box dining room, based on the theme of food, music and design.

The students came up with an excellent concept, which worked perfectly and brought the whole room together.

07/08/2008 // Off the Walls // Leeds Met Gallery Studio & Theatre.

 

 
 
 

Beginning in September 2008, the Leeds Met Gallery took several school and college

groups on a creative journey stimulated by the visual artwork in their gallery.  

Looking at the work of Alex Hartley and Banksy, and working alongside graffiti creative Faunagraphic and The Paper Birds Drama collective, groups were encouraged to create brand new works that coincide with architecture, street art, graffiti, self expression and the use of mixed media. All of the works that were produced formed part of a festival of arts just before Christmas in 2008.
